Xojo Conferences

Platforms to show: All Mac Windows Linux Cross-Platform

CURLSEmailMBS class

class, CURL, MBS CURL Plugin (CURLS), class CURLSEmailMBS,
Plugin version: 14.3, Mac: Yes, Win: Yes, Linux: Yes, Console & Web: Yes, Feedback.

Function: Our plugin class to help building and sending emails.
dim e as new CURLSEmailMBS

e.SetFrom "test@test.test", "christian Müller"
e.Subject = "Hello World ☺️"
e.SMTPPassword = "xxx"
e.SMTPUsername = "xxx"
e.SetServer "smtp.test.test", true
e.AddTo "test@test.test", "Test Müller"
e.PlainText = "Hello World," + EndOfLine + "Smilies: ☺️ 😘 😄"

dim c as new CURLSMBS

if c.SetupEmail(e) then

dim er as integer = c.Perform
if er = 0 then
MsgBox "Email sent"
end if
end if
Notes: Please use CURLSEmailMBS with CURLSMBS (with S for static library) and CURLEmailMBS with CURLMBS (bring your own curl library).

This class has no sub classes.

Some methods using this class:

The items on this page are in the following plugins: MBS CURL Plugin.

CURLNotInitializedExceptionMBS   -   CURLSFileInfoMBS

The biggest plugin in space...

MBS Xojo Plugins